Like ⋅ Add a comment ⋅ Pin to Ideaboard ⋅ Bright yellow is the perfect colour for hallways and entry’s, its bright and welcoming. Bright yellow is not good for areas you want to rest in…bedrooms, lounge rooms, children’s rooms. It’s too lively a colour and will keep you jumping. The darker shades of yellow is much better for the above rooms.
